Although there are several United States coin series that can make the claim that they are the most popular with American collectors, the steady favorite in the latter decades has been the Morgan silver dollars. These dollars were minted from 1878 to 1904 and then again in 1921 at five U.S. mints, including Philadelphia (no mint mark), New Orleans, San Francisco, Carson City and Denver.  The Morgan dollar coins, so aptly named after their designer, George T. Morgan, feature on the obverse a profile of Lady Liberty wearing a slave’s cap, which is an ancient symbol for freedom. The reverse of the coins show an American bald eagle poised in flight, clutching in its talons the arrows of war and the olive branch of peace.
